
How to Choose a Pressure Cleaning Company in Adelaide
To choose a good pressure cleaning company in Adelaide, look for public liability insurance, a written quote that lists each surface with the method named against it, and an operator who will soft wash your render and roof rather than blast them. The biggest red flag is a company that proposes high pressure for everything, because that is faster for them and risky for your property. Compare at least a few quotes on method as well as price, and favour operators who explain their approach clearly.

The non-negotiables
Start with insurance. A legitimate Adelaide operator carries public liability cover, and will happily confirm it. If a company hesitates or cannot produce it, walk away, because any damage to your property or a neighbour's becomes your problem.
Next is the written quote. It should list each surface separately and name the cleaning method for each. That is the fastest way to tell a professional from someone who plans to point a high-pressure wand at your whole house.
The method test
The single best question you can ask is: how will you clean my render and my roof? The right answer is a soft wash. If the operator says they will high-pressure them, you have learned everything you need to know.
A company that understands method will proactively explain why your concrete driveway suits high pressure while your rendered walls and roof need a gentle, solution-based clean. That knowledge is what you are paying for, and it is what separates a clean that lifts your home from one that damages it.
Red flags to watch for
Some warning signs are consistent across Adelaide. A quote that is dramatically cheaper than the others usually means corners are being cut, most often by blasting surfaces that should be soft washed. Vague, verbal-only quotes leave you no protection if the job goes wrong.
Pressure to pay a large deposit upfront, no fixed business address or ABN, and an inability to explain the method are all reasons to keep looking.
- No public liability insurance.
- Suspiciously low quote versus the others.
- High pressure proposed for render, paint, timber or roof.
- Verbal-only quote with no surface-by-surface detail.
- No ABN, no reviews, large upfront deposit demanded.
